Q: How do I trace a request across Lanewick microservices during an incident? A: Every inbound call gets a trace token at the Ferrow edge proxy, propagated via headers to downstream services. Search the Opaline trace viewer by token. If the viewer's encrypted session store rejects your on-call account, unlock it with the passphrase below.

vault phrase of tajop-haduf = holath-brivan-wenax

Subject: Pool car key cabinet

Hi all — the pool car keys for the Westbourne fleet now live in the grey cabinet behind reception. Staff must sign the log before taking a key and return keys by 18:00. Report missing fobs to facilities the same day. The cabinet opens with the code below.

door code, yagap-bahof: bdg-O-05

## Mergewell Environments

Mergewell, our customer-record deduplication service, runs in three environments: sandbox, staging, and production. Sandbox uses synthetic records only; staging gets a scrubbed weekly snapshot; production matches live records from the Fernhollow CRM. Match thresholds differ per environment on purpose — sandbox is deliberately aggressive so tests surface edge cases. Each environment reads its own config; production currently runs with these values.

service settings:
WENOX_PIN=1918
WENOX_METRICS_HOST=metrics.wenox.lumicworks.corp
WENOX_LOG_LEVEL=info
WENOX_TENANT=belion

MEMO — Kettling Depot Receiving

Uniform sets for the new Kettling depot arrive Wednesday via Ashgrove courier: 40 boxes, sorted by size, manifest attached to box one. Check the count at the dock before signing; shortages go straight to stores, not the courier. The hand-over instruction the courier will follow is set out below.

drop instructions, tafof-baguf: the holmir gilox courier leaves the sormir ulaok holdor ledger at gate 5596 under passcode 257343

## Swapping out the old queue

Heads up for the sync: we're finally retiring Crankshaft, the homegrown job queue, in favor of Relayline. The migration shim dual-writes jobs to both systems for two weeks so we can diff throughput and failure rates. Workers pick up Relayline config automatically — no code changes on your end, just redeploy. One manual step remains: each worker box needs the Relayline broker credential in its env file, specifically this line:

sealed setting: VAULT_KEY13=741e0a90de233